This study was conducted to analyze the effect of accounting prior knowledge, self-efficacy, and interest in the level of understanding of accounting majors accounting PGRI Adi Buana University of Surabaya. The approach used in this research is quantitative. Populations are the second semester students 2014/2015 Accounting Department of Economics, PGRI Adi Buana University with a sample of 156 students. Data were analyzed using Structural Equation Modeling (SEM). The results showed that there was a significant effect of prior knowledge of accounting and self efficacy on the interest in learning, and learning interest influencing the level of understanding
